Tustin, United States
13270 Newport Ave
N/A
+1 7147861215
I think that this is a mobile business... I drove there to copy a key... GSP took me to Albertson's, and I didn't see a storefront for a locksmith... That's kinda shady to waste people's time and energy like that...
like
Key wasnt copied properly.
Deli
The best companies in the category 'Deli'